 Happy 5-Year Anniversary LB
Our little site hits the 5-year old mark today as we launched on 8/6/2004.
Remember the excitement with a new coach (Mooch), young QB (ballgame), the potentially best WR combo in the league (CRog and Roy), and a new RB (KJ). A 4-2 start had everyone thinking playoffs.
Most of us are still big fans who would just like to see our team get to some sort of respectability.
Thanks to all the forum members, you are what the site is all about.
